I was diagnosed pre-diabetic 15 years ago. told myself, no biggie, I can change shit up. I never did, obviously. fast forward to Thanksgiving of last year, doc said "why don't you try the dexcom 7 patch/receiver". so I did! down 40 pounds and generally feeling much better. no drugs, no new exercise. just knowing what I was eating, that was causing issues. just had a checkup last month. doc says "whatever you are doing, you're levels are at pre-diabetic levels!! keep it up".
I think I recall a post that Buck had "sugar is killing us, and is in everything" or something like that. its' amazing what's in our food and how horrible we are eating as a society.
